---JBrett <tbarwick@esn.net> wrote:
>
>
> ld b,8 ;times to loop
> loop1:
> push bc ; push bc (times to loop)
> ld hl,$FC00 ;point to video mem
> ld b,255 ;times to go through next loop
> loop11:
> srl (hl)
> inc hl ;hl+1->hl
> djnz loop11 ;if b is not 0, decrement b and jump to loop11
> ld b,255 ;times to go through next loop
> loop12:
> srl (hl)
> inc hl ; hl+1->hl
> djnz loop12 ; if b is not 0, decrement b and jump to loop12
> ld b,255 ;times to go through next loop
> loop13:
> srl (hl)
> inc hl ; hl+1->hl
> djnz loop13 ; if b is not 0, decrement b and jump to loop13
> ld b,255 ;times to go through loop
> loop14:
> srl (hl)
> inc hl ; hl+1->hl
> djnz loop14 ; if b is not 0, decrement b and jump to loop14
> ei ; enable interrupts
> ld b,6 ; times to run through "del_loop"
> del_loop:
> halt ; wait for interrupt to occur
> djnz del_loop ; if b is not 0, decrement b and jump to
del_loop (runs
> 6 times)
> di ; disable interrupts
> pop bc ;get number of times to loop (8 on first
loop)
> djnz loop1 ;if b is not 0, decrement b and jump to loop1
> (beginning)
>
> This code is 44 bytes/247 cc's
> This code really needs to be optimized... like this: =)
>
> ld b,8
> ld c,5
> Start:
> push bc
> ld hl, $fc00
> loop:
> ld b,255
> dec c
> shift_loop:
> srl (hl)
> inc l
> djnz shift_loop
> ld b,c
> djnz loop
> ld b,6
> ld c,5
> ei
> del_loop:
> halt
> djnz del_loop
> di
> pop bc
> djnz Start
>
> I wrote this pretty fast, but I think it will probably work... 29
bytes/ 150
> cc's
While this DOES make it faster, it also robs it of it's coolest efect.
Now if it was smaller and the SAME SPEED, that would be even better.
